Supongamos que tengo varios registros dañados y me he obligado a depurarme y recrearme a como pueda…
/*Primero tengo que declarar la variable que almacenará el número de decepciones que he tenido*/
DECLARE @Decepciones INT
/*Filtro mis pensamientos y con los positivos alimento mi ego*/
SELECT *
INTO #Ego
FROM Pensamientos
WHERE Autoestima = MAX(Autoestima)
/*Me elimino los pensamientos malos*/
DELETE Pensamientos
WHERE PensamientoId NOT IN (SELECT PensamientoId FROM #Ego)
/*Calculo el número de decepciones que almacena mi corazón*/
SELECT @Decepciones = COUNT(SentimientoId)
FROM Corazon
WHERE (Sentimiento LIKE ‘%dolor%’
OR Sentimiento LIKE ‘%depresión%’)
/*Empiezo a crear un lugarcito para recaudar mis aprendizajes*/
CREATE TABLE Fortaleza
(
FortalezaId INT IDENTITY(1,1),
Virtudes CHAR(50),
)
/*Por cada decepción creo una fortaleza en mí*/
WHILE @Decepciones > 0
BEGIN
INSERT INTO Fortalezas
(Virtudes)
values (RAND(Valores))
SET @Decepciones = @Decepciones -1
END
/*Elimino todos mis sentimientos que me hacen daño*/
DELETE Corazon
WHERE (Sentimiento LIKE ‘%dolor%’
OR Sentimiento LIKE ‘%depresión%’)
/*Elimino el Ego, al fin y al cabo con buena autoestima tengo*/
DROP TABLE #Ego
Esto es rebane, no crean que estoy tan traumada mmm… ¡¡¡¡en serio!!!!
jajaja…buenisimo!!!…si quieres haz una red neuronal para que simules sin dolor…y ya vez que puede agregarse redundancia..:mrgreen:
Pos ta bien… lo único malo es que tu #Ego solo va a tener un registro y tus virtudes son todas aleatoreas (aunque en la vida real, eso no es cierto… espero! :P).
Lo más importante es hacer el último DELETE y que las @Decepciones no se incrementen mientras estás en el ciclo WHILE .
ínimo, Chica Regia. 😉
Candyyy!!!!!!!!!!!!!! no pues ahora si que me has enseñado una buena forma practica de aplicar el sql no cabe duda!!!!
y me da mucho gusto que te sientas mejor… o por lo menos asi lo trato de entender no lo crees!!!!!!!!!
un super mega abrazote para ti
pues hay que hacer mas INSERTS con pensamientos buenos… 🙂
Hola Chica Regia
Mientras no te de un: error fatal SQL oe:01800eecd001 todo esta bien! saludos.
konchudo
BUENISIMOOO!!!
:shock::shock: que caray, pues sin comentarios candy, jeje esperemos que los campos de las virtudes sean lo suficiente mente grandes para poder almacenarlas todas 😛
¡Qué estupendo! ¿Y tienes algo para rebajar barriga?
jejejej no pues si esta curado de hecho
ya quisiera que en realidad se me pudiera instalar los programas asi de facil ejejejeje
aa como seria facil la vida con algunos scrips en la cabeza
jajajajajajaj y si le entendiera al sql seria mas divertido
ESTA CHEVERE….ERES RE-LOCA :lol::mrgreen:
Pues todo esta muy bien, solo hay que tener mucho cuidado con tu base de datos ya que no se pueden hacer respaldos de seguridad.. 😉 besos y bytes